About Tulip Inn Newcastle Gateshead
Stylish and modern 3-star hotel located only 2.5 miles from central Newcastle and positioned just off the A1. The hotel is within easy reach of all the North East provides, including the Metro Centre, Quayside Nightlife and Newcastle. All bedrooms offer stylish and comfortable accommodation. All are en suite with walk-in power showers, fluffy duvets, free wireless connections, interactive TV with satellite stations including Sky Sports, a direct dial phone, trouser press, iron with ironing board, hairdryer and tea/coffee making facilities. Public areas are non-smoking. Bibo Bistro serves a full English breakfast and evening meals. The stylish bar area offers comfort and relaxation. The hotel opened in October 2004. Escomb (18.3 miles, 29.4 km, direction N)
Lying in a prominent position ringed by the River Wear, Escomb is best known for its magnificent Saxon Church reputed to be built from stones brought from the near-by ruined Roman Fort at Binchester.

Seaton Sluice (12.5 miles, 20.1 km, direction SW)
For centuries salt had been panned in the region, at this time the village was known as Hartley Pans, but this appears to have changed following the building of a harbour with a sluice at the harbour mouth.
